Hi

Try to reset the unit by disconnecting the power supply for 10sec. and operate the unit. If it wont work replace your Room Air and Coil Thersmistor or test the thersmistor with mulitester. The resistance reading of thermistor is 10 kilo ohms @25deg. C room temp. If it is shorted or open the unit wont operate.

The operation and timer lights on my Fujitsu split system are flashing on and off several times when the unit is switched off I noticed this after the system had stopped blowing air & I knew the room...

I have same problem like yours to my newly installed Fujitsu multi-split system (the first time use since system installed 1 week ago). I rang the electrician who did the installation; he said it must be the units themselves nothing to do with electricity.

Okay, then I rang Fujitsu and their local service agent. They suggested me to switch off C/B for an hour to reset the units. I followed the instruction but the indoor units still did not respond to remote control...

It simply looks like no power supply to indoor units (they are hard-wired to the outdoor unit). So I used a multi-meter to test the power terminals of indoor units (Danger! If you have no idea about this, don't even try! ): it seemed no power supply even C/B is on. I turned to the isolator which next to the outdoor unit. The isolator was making arcing noise when I switched it on and off. The indoor units suddenly turned on for few minutes then died again.

So I figured out the problem is that crooked isolator. I called the unhappy electrician to replace the isolator. End story....

TIMEX IRONMAN TRIATHALON DIGITAL WRISTWATCH

ANALOG TIME
Pull CROWN and turn to set HOUR and MINUTE hands. TIME AND DATE A. Press and hold SET. SECONDS digits will flash. B. Press SPLIT/RESET to set SECONDS to zero. C. Press MODE to select HOURS. D. Press SPLIT/RESET to advance hours digits. Go through 12 hours for AM or PM. E. Press MODE to select MINUTES, press SPLIT/RESET to advance. F. Repeat to set MONTH, DATE, DAY, 12- or 24-hour time display. G. Press SET when done. BASIC OPERATIONS Press MODE to cycle through CHRONO, TIMER, and ALARM modes. Press INDIGLO to illuminate watch face. In any mode, press MODE to view time display. Press any button to stop alarm or timer beeps. INDIGLO INDIGLO CHRONOGRAPH A. Press MODE until CHRONO appears. B. Press START/STOP to start. C. Press SPLIT/RESET to record lap time. Display pauses. D. Press MODE to resume display of lap and split time (automatic after 10 seconds). E. Press START/STOP to pause chrono. F. Press START/STOP to resume. G. Press START/STOP to stop. H. When timing is stopped, press SPLIT/RESET repeatedly to recall last eight lap and split times. I. Press and hold SPLIT/RESET to reset chrono. MODE MODE START/ STOP START/ STOP SPLIT/ RESET SPLIT/ RESET SET SET CROWN COUNTDOWN TIMER A. Press MODE until TIMER appears. B. Press SPLIT/RESET to select timer operation (Countdown and Stop; Countdown and Repeat; Countdown and Start chrono). C. Press SET. HOURS digits will flash. Press SPLIT/RESET to advance digits. D. Press MODE to select TENS of MINUTES. Press SPLIT/RESET to advance. E. Repeat to set MINUTES, TENS of SECONDS, and SECONDS. F. Press SET when done. G. Press START/STOP to start timer. H. Press START/STOP to pause, press again to resume. I. When timer is stopped, press SPLIT/RESET to reset timer. Watch will beep when countdown reaches zero. ALARM AND CHIME A. Press MODE until ALARM appears. B. Press SET to select HOURS. Digits will flash. C. Press SPLIT/RESET to advance digits. Go through 12 hours for AM or PM. D. Press MODE to select TENS of MINUTES. E. Press SPLIT/RESET to advance. Repeat for MINUTES. F. Press SET when done. G. Press START/STOP to turn alarm on or off. H. Press SPLIT/RESET to turn chime on or off. When alarm time is reached, watch will beep for 20 seconds, or until any button is pushed. Alarm will repeat every 24 hours until deactivated. INDIGLO® NIGHT-LIGHT WITH NIGHT-MODE® FEATURE A. Press INDIGLO to activate light. Patented (U.S. Patent Numbers 4,527,096 and 4,775,964) electroluminescent technology used in the INDIGLO® night-light illuminates watch face at night and in low light conditions. B. Press and hold INDIGLO for three seconds (beep will sound) to activate or de-activate NIGHT-MODE® feature. C. While in NIGHT-MODE® feature, press any button to illuminate watch face for 3 seconds. Chime on Alarm on If your watch is water-resistant, meter marking or ( ) is indicated. Water-Resistance Depth p.s.i.a.* Water Pressure Below Surface 30m/98ft 60 50m/164ft 86 100m/328ft 160 *pounds per square inch absolute WATER AND SHOCK RESISTANCE WARNING: TO MAINTAIN WATER-RESISTANCE, DO NOT PRESS ANY BUTTONS UNDER WATER. 1. Watch is water-resistant only as long as lens, push buttons and case remain intact. 2. Watch is not a diver watch and should not be used for diving. 3. Rinse watch with fresh water after exposure to salt water. 4. Shock resistance will be indicated on the watch face or caseback. Watches are designed to pass ISO test for shock resistance.
